1. What is the full form of CD ?

Explanation

The full form of CD is compact disk. This is a type of optical storage medium that is used to store and play back digital information. The term "compact" refers to the small size of the disk, which is typically 12 centimeters in diameter. CDs are commonly used for storing music, videos, and computer software. They are known for their durability and ability to hold large amounts of data.

2. What is program ?

Explanation

A program refers to a set of instructions that are written in a specific programming language to perform a particular task or achieve a specific goal. These instructions guide the computer on what operations to execute, how to process data, and how to interact with the user or other systems. By following these instructions, the computer can complete various tasks, such as calculations, data manipulation, and control flow. Therefore, the correct answer is "set of instructions."

3. What is flow chart ?

Explanation

A flow chart is a pictorial representation of an algorithm. It is a visual tool that uses various symbols and arrows to depict the sequence of steps or actions in a process. It helps in understanding the flow of logic or operations in a program or system. By using different shapes and connectors, a flow chart provides a clear and concise representation of an algorithm, making it easier to analyze and communicate.

4. What is firmware ?

Explanation

Firmware refers to a type of software that is embedded into a hardware device. It provides low-level control and instructions for the hardware, allowing it to perform specific functions. Unlike regular software, firmware is stored in non-volatile memory, such as ROM or flash memory, and remains intact even when the device is powered off. Therefore, the correct answer "hardware with instruction" accurately describes the nature of firmware, highlighting its close relationship with hardware devices and its role in providing instructions for their operation.

5. What is 1 MB ?

Explanation

1 MB is equivalent to 1024 kilobytes. In computer storage, memory, and data transfer, the binary system is used where each unit is a power of 2. Therefore, 1 MB is equal to 1024 KB, not 1000 KB. This is because 1024 is the closest power of 2 to 1000, making it the standard conversion factor.
